Update from the Course 

Three weeks into the recovery period of the course renovations and we are tracking in the right direction. Fairways and green surrounds are looking a treat and the new growth on these areas is very encouraging. The height of cut for both these playing surfaces has been lowered to 13mm from their previous height of 15mm. This creates a far better definition of the hole layout and who knows, might even give you an extra 20m off the tee!

The squared off tee decks look amazing; this has been well accepted by members and guests so far. The amount of original useable tee deck that has been lost is next to nothing. The areas that have now become tee surrounds were either a slope or swale and could not have tee markers placed their anyhow. Visually as these tee stations grow, they will become spectacular.

Greens are recovering at a pace a little bit slower than I had hoped for.  They are currently at 60% which is what I had promised after 3 weeks but with the heat and rain of late I really thought they would have exploded a little more. There was a lot of thatch removed and certain weak areas on greens didn't appreciate their new haircut at all. The first cut on the greens was a late afternoon dry cut eight days after the renovation process. We have applied a second granular fertiliser as a base nutrient for the greens and will continue with weekly foliar fertilisers to encourage more growth. We are now back to daily mowing and can see improvement in the putting surface each time we cut. Sand now becomes our best friend with weekly dustings required to get the surface back to its original billiard table look. There are still plenty of core holes visible and if this rain ever stops, we will be able to implement a regular topdressing programme.

The step cut around the greens has become more noticeable every time we lower the greens height of cut. We are currently cutting greens at 3.5mm and the step cut is at 8mm. Going forward the greens final height of cut will be 3mm all year round which will create great definition between the two playing surfaces.

Once again thanks very much for your patience during this recovery period, it is very much appreciated.

What's the Buzz......

Hard to believe but one day we actually had a day without any rain and after work was complete on the course we managed to fit in a hive inspection to check in on the bees. It's easy to see where the saying, "As busy as a bee" comes from when you remove the lid from the hives. No honeycomb under the roof this time which was a good sign and both hives were happy and healthy. They have already started to refill the honey frames from the last extraction and there's plenty of freed up from with lots of empty cells ready to be filled.

We carried out a varroa mite test on both hives as required by the Dept of Primary industries every 4 months in Queensland. Varroa mite is an external parasitic mite that attacks and feeds on honeybees and is one of the most damaging threats to bees in the world. This mite all but destroyed the honey industry in NSW over the past couple of years but luckily (or well-planned management) has not had an impact on QLD yet with only one case of varroa mite found in the state this year.  Both our hives were negative to Varroa, and the bees went about their normal day.

Renovation Local Rules

Due to golf course renovations, we are currently playing PREFERRED LIE through the general area.  Additionally, if your golf ball comes to rest in a core hole on the putting surface you may place your ball out of the cored hole on the putting green to the side of its original position not nearer the hole. 


Blue Cart Directional Signage and Lines.

This week we have added some new blue cart directional signage and lines to the surrounds of putting greens. Since the introduction of the Visage 4 GPS system in September, we have been able to keep club carts well away from putting greens and surrounds, however we are still noticing too much cart wear close to greens.  The purpose of the blue lines is to make it abundantly clear how far carts are to remain from surrounds and putting surfaces, so please, do not cross the blue lines when driving a cart on course.  Staff will be policing this and in addition, we ask the lowest marker in each group to take responsibility for ensuring all members of the group adhere to the rule.  Please play your part in allowing us to deliver the quality of playing surface we all want to see.
